General information
Service offered: Advice and information on a range of issues including housing rights, welfare rights and benefits, disability, money/debt, consumer rights and employment rights, relationship issues.
Target group: General public.
Area served: Canterbury, Herne Bay, Whitstable & Neighbouring Villages
How to contact: Drop-in (Limited, please check website), phone (Canterbury 01227452762 / Herne Bay 01227 740647 / National Adviceline 0808 278 7846) or write.
